Animal vs. Vegan Leather
Animal leather production emits significant amounts of CO₂ at every stage of its lifecycle, from cattle farming and feed production to tanning, finishing, and global transportation. On average, the production of one square metre of cow leather generates approximately 17kg of CO₂.
Beyond animal welfare concerns, traditional leather presents serious environmental challenges for the fashion industry. Livestock farming alone is responsible for over half of the fashion industry’s methane emissions, making leather a key contributor to climate change. Combined with higher production costs and retail prices, these factors have led many consumers to seek alternatives.
Historically, this demand resulted in the rise of synthetic vegan leather. Due to its lower cost of production and accessibility, plastic-based alternatives quickly gained popularity as cruelty-free substitutes for animal leather.
The History of Vegan Leather
Today, it is common to find products labelled “vegan leather” on the high street, most often made from PVC or polyester. While these materials avoid the use of animal products, they are not inherently sustainable.
Synthetic leathers rely on fossil fuel extraction and chemical-intensive manufacturing processes. These chemicals are released into the environment during production and throughout the product’s lifecycle. Although synthetic leather typically produces slightly less CO₂ than animal leather—around 15–16kg per square metre—it still contributes significantly to carbon emissions.
At the end of their lifespan, synthetic leathers pose an even greater environmental issue. As polymer-derived materials, they do not biodegrade in the same way animal leather can. As a result, despite being cruelty-free and more affordable, synthetic leathers often contribute more to long-term physical pollution and landfill waste.
The Rise of Bio-Based Leathers
In recent years, a new generation of vegan leather has emerged: bio-based leather. These materials replace animal products and reduce reliance on synthetic plastics by using naturally derived sources such as plants, fruits, and agricultural waste.
Many bio-based leathers are created using by-products from other industries, such as apple pulp from juice production, which enhances their circular and resource-efficient appeal. This approach reduces waste while creating innovative, functional materials.
Few designers are as closely associated with bio-based leather innovation as Stella McCartney, who has never used animal leather in her collections. Her brand has pioneered the use of mycelium (fungi-based leather), grape leather, and Mirum—a plastic-free natural rubber composite—across luxury shoes, bags, and accessories.
Following McCartney’s lead, other brands have rapidly adopted bio-based alternatives. Veja has championed their use within the sneaker industry, while brands such as Themoire have integrated them into the vegan accessories market.
The Future of Vegan Bio-Leathers
Bio-based leathers currently represent the most ethical and low-impact alternative to traditional leather, yet they are not without limitations. Many materials still rely on small amounts of synthetic binders or coatings to improve durability, flexibility, or finish. This compromises full biodegradability and complicates end-of-life disposal.
In addition, bio-based leathers have not yet consistently matched the longevity or water resistance of animal or fully synthetic leather. As these materials are relatively new, they have not been tested across long-term use cycles. However, this does not suggest failure—rather, it highlights the need for continued innovation and material development.
Encouragingly, progress is already being made. Some bio-based leathers can now be broken down and recycled, helping to divert waste from landfill. Other bio-leather producers have begun producing next-gen materials which use no plastic whatsoever, including Mirum and Treekind. Other inventive materials derived from coffee grounds, corn, bamboo, cactus, and even peanut shells have entered commercial production, and we can expect to see more bio-based leather free themselves from plastics as they head towards a truly ethical fashion future. Companies such as Desserto, Piñatex, and Oleatex continue to grow rapidly, securing new partnerships and advancing material science each year.
